BJD Infighting In Bhubaneswar: Will There Be Action Against Indiscipline ?

Bhubaneswar: Infighting in Biju Janata Dal (BJD) appears to be heating up the political atmosphere in Odisha, particularly in state capital Bhubaneswar. Groupism and infighting which had surfaced in the regional party before the simultaneous twin elections still persists even after its poll debacle. What started from an intense lobby for election tickets, subsequently led to fight among corporators of Bhubaneswar Municipal Corporation (BMC). While internal rift came to the fore following controversial statements by leaders, the dispute in the party even reached the police recently. While around 30 BJD corporators of BMC went to Puri for darshan at Loknath Temple on Monday, four leaders were issued show cause notice by the party over indiscipline.

Show Cause After Quarrel

The Naveen Patnaik-led party has initiated a significant step. BJD’s Bhubaneswr district unit president Sushant Rout has issued show cause notice to four leaders, including corporators Amaresh Jena and Biranchi Narayan Mahasupakar. Youth leader Rakesh Patra and students’ leader Bibek Swain have also been issued notice. They have been asked to explain within 15 days as to why disciplinary action should be taken against them for indulging in indiscipline inside the party.

‘Never Created Fissures In BJD’

After being issued show cause notice, corporator Amaresh Jena has claimed that he never tried to create fissures in the party and said that everyone is aware of what happened in Bhubaneswar. Stating that BJD has gathered strength with the cooperation of all, he said strategic moves by Naveen Patnaik always prove effective in the party. Similarly, Biranchi also claimed that he never indulged in any act of indiscipline or anti-party activities. He said other leaders who committed mistake should also be issued show cause notice.

Puri Visit Of Corporators

Amid political heat in Bhubaneswar over quarrel among corporators, around 30 BJD corporators have undertaken a bus journey to the pilgrim town of Puri. It is stated that the corporators opposing Amaresh and Biranchi have gone to Puri for darshan at Loknath Temple. Though it is claimed that they are visiting Loknath Temple to pray for the wellbeing of Naveen Patnaik, the real reason is said to be different. The main objective is stated to be bringing together all corporators against Amaresh and Biranchi.

Fire Of Resentment

Resentment among BJD leaders in Bhubaneswar has been brewing before the twin elections. There was a bitter faceoff between Ananta Narayan Jena and Amaresh Jena to bag party ticket for Bhubaneswar Central Assembly seat. Similarly, Bhubaneswar Ekamra seat witnessed stiff competition between Ashok Chandra Panda and Biranchi Mahasupakar. Finally, Ananta Jena and Ashok Panda fought the Assembly elections with BJD ticket, but the party had to face the consequences of revolt. Ekamra seat slipped out of its hand, while Ananta Jena managed to win with a thin margin. Since then, infighting in BJD has assumed serious proportions. Amaresh once alleged that Ashok Panda and Ananta Jena have been trying to divide party corporators in order to increase their influence. Subsequently, around 24 BJD corporators had gathered in a hotel. Chaotic scenes were also witnessed during a party meeting in Sankha Bhawan recently with Amaresh and Biranchi indirectly targeting Ashok Panda. Biranchi’s supporters later lodged a complaint with the police against Ashok Pana and Rakesh Patra. Amid growing internal rift, it may turn out to be a major challenge for BJD to keep the flocks together.
